Our Awana ministry exists to help build lasting foundations of faith in the hearts and lives of our children. Each night includes a teaching lesson from God’s Word, singing, memory verses, and fun games.
Awana clubs meet weekly every Sunday night (during the school year) from 5:30 – 7:00 pm. Awana is open to all children preschool – 5th grade.

Our Youth group ministry exists to help reach the youth of our community with the Gospel of Jesus Christ and to help equip them to walk with Jesus faithfully in the world where they live.
Youth group meets every Sunday night (during the school year) from 5:30 – 7:00 pm. Each meeting consists of an interactive lesson from the Bible, group discussions, games and fun with other students.
Our Youth group also participates with Truth 4 Youth throughout the year as they host exciting events for churches in the Mid-Michigan area.
